Kadambatal

Kadambatal is a village located in the Rayagada Subdivision of Gajapati district,Odisha, India. Kadambatal has a population of 259 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Jalango Gram Panchayat and the Rayagada Block Panchayat in Rayagada District. The village has 63 households and is identified by village code 414746. Kadambatal is located in the 761213 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Rayagada Sub-District.

Total Population of Kadambatal

As of the 2011 census, Population of Kadambatal has a population of approximately 259 people, where the male population is 129 and the female population is 130.

Total 259
Male 129
Female 130

Household in Kadambatal

There are approximately 63 households in Kadambatal. The average household size in the village is about 4 persons per house.

Understanding Literacy Rates in Kadambatal Village

As per the 2011 Census, Kadambatal presents important statistics regarding its literacy and illiteracy rates.

Literacy in Kadambatal Village (2011):

Total 89
Male 58
Female 31

illiteracy in Kadambatal Village (2011):

Total 170
Male 71
Female 99
